(4) For Whisper models
|
||||
|
||||
python3 ./python-api-examples/offline-decode-files.py \
|
||||
--whisper-encoder=./sherpa-onnx-whisper-base.en/base.en-encoder.int8.onnx \
|
||||
--whisper-decoder=./sherpa-onnx-whisper-base.en/base.en-decoder.int8.onnx \
|
||||
--tokens=./sherpa-onnx-whisper-base.en/base.en-tokens.txt \
|
||||
--num-threads=1 \
|
||||
./sherpa-onnx-whisper-base.en/test_wavs/0.wav \
|
||||
./sherpa-onnx-whisper-base.en/test_wavs/1.wav \
|
||||
./sherpa-onnx-whisper-base.en/test_wavs/8k.wav
|
||||
|
||||
Please refer to
|
||||
https://k2-fsa.github.io/sherpa/onnx/index.html
|
||||
to install sherpa-onnx and to download the pre-trained models
